MANAGUA - One week before Nicaraguans vote for a new president, a poll released yesterday said the left wing former president, Mr Daniel Ortega, had moved ahead of his right wing rival, Mr Arnoldo Aleman. The CINCO S.A. poll gave Mr Ortega, who led Nicaragua's Marxist Sandinista government from 1979 to 1990, 36.7 per cent of the vote and Mr Aleman 33.9 per cent of the vote.
